What Is A Tech Stack? This is the foremost question in the mind of an aspiring software developer ready to build a software product.
Technology stack means the set of tools, programming languages, and technologies that function together to build digital products or solutions. These include websites, mobile, and web apps.
Since you know what a Tech Stack in the UK is, it’ll help you understand how to choose the technologies and tools parallel to your project’s objectives. With this understanding, it’ll increase your chances of developing a cost-effective software product that users will love.
What is an illustration of a tech stack?
It’s essential to know that not all tech stacks for web development are created equally. Thus choosing a suitable application tech can be demanding, particularly for startups and small businesses. When they get it right, their software projects will be mobilized effectively.
What is an example of a proven tech stack model that’ll save time and cost? The following are examples of proven tech stack models.
- MERN: The component of MERN is similar to MEAN, and you have to change Angular.js with React. MERN is beneficial due to its React integration and ability to simultaneously use code on browsers and servers. Plus, powerful library and full-stack development options (frontend and backend).
- MEVN: What is a tech stack without MEVN? It uses Vue.js as the frontend web framework instead of Angular.js. Web developers will like it because it’s easy to learn, delivers a clear programming style, and provides superb performance for web applications.
- Python: As part of the fastest-growing languages, Python is easy to use and generally taught to college students as a beginner development language. It’s perfect for building web applications using the popular Django web framework.
- Java: Although its popularity is declining, Java is suitable for enterprise applications. However, current projects are inclined to newer, lighter-weight application stacks like Node.js and Python.
How do you make the perfect tech stack?
What is a perfect tech stack? There is no one-size-fit technology stack for your project; the perfect one depends on the application you want to build. Part of the factors to consider when picking your tech stack are the application requirements and the business purpose you want to solve.
Suppose your web application will interact with many other systems or needs frequent database interactions. In that case, you should use sophisticated tools and frameworks for workflow integration between various systems.
Finally, a single-page application project will need access to lightweight technologies like React.